Recorded during her Speak Now World Tour in 2011, this live recording collects 18 performances from the country-pop starlet, including almost all songs from her 2010 studio album "Speak Now".

Plot Summary

This concert film captures Taylor Swift's electrifying "Speak Now" World Tour, showcasing her dynamic performance and connection with her fans. The tour spanned across North America, South America, Europe, and Australia, featuring elaborate stage productions and Swift's signature blend of country-pop anthems and heartfelt ballads. It highlights the artist's growth into a global superstar during this era.

Critical Reception

The "Speak Now" World Tour Live was generally well-received by fans and critics alike, praised for Taylor Swift's energetic stage presence, impressive production values, and the emotional connection she maintained with her audience. It was seen as a significant milestone in her career, demonstrating her ability to command large stadium crowds and deliver a polished, entertaining show.
